WebThere are two consistency models in DynamoDB for reads (i.e. GetItem). Eventual Consistency on read (default) Strongly Consistency on read The main difference to the one reading is that on Eventual Consistency, there is a small chance that you may get stale data (i.e. old). Conversely, on Strongly Consistency, you get the most latest data. Each Region is independent and isolated from other Amazon Regions. For … onn preamplifierWebJul 10, 2024 · Firstly, writes to DynamoDB are very expensive. Secondly, strongly consistent reads are twice the cost of eventually consistent reads. And thirdly, workloads performing scans can quickly get cost prohibitive. This is because the read capacity units actually take the number of bytes read into account.
